ORGAN RECITAL
TOWN HALL TO-MORROW Mendelssohn’s second sonata, the Toccata in G, by Dubois, and Bacli’s Pastorale Suite will be included in the programme for the recital in the I'own Hall to-morrow (Sunday) evening. Mr. Maughan Barnett will also play transcriptions of Schubert’s “On the Waters” and March in D, and Rubenstein’s well-known Melody.
